Arizona vs Colorado Game Final 6-4 - Matt Peacock Earns Win
Arizona moneyline bettors cashed on Wednesday courtesy of a 6-4 win against the Colorado Rockies at Chase Field.
Arizona was an underdog by -102 and came through for bettors backing them. The game went OVER the consensus closing total of 9.5.
Matt Peacock earned the victory for the Diamondbacks, throwing 3 innings of work, striking out 2, walking 1, and allowing 3 hits and 1 earned runs. That effort was supported by 3 RBIs from Eduardo Escobar in the win.
Colorado got a 1-inning outing from Mychal Givens in the loss. He gave up 0 earned runs, 0 walks and 0 hits in his time on the mound, while Ryan McMahon had 3 hits in the loss for the Rockies.
Colorado enjoyed an edge at the plate with a 10-9 advantage in hits.
Joakim Soria pitched the final 1 innings for the save. He struck out 2 and allowed 0 hits in his outing.
